Subject: Handover — Lockerline access flow

Hi Mira,

Handing over the Lockerline laundry-locker access service before my leave. The access flow writes door-open events to the `locker_events` table and checks reservations against `active_slots`. Known issue: the Tuesday batch job occasionally leaves orphaned reservations; the cleanup script in `ops/purge_stale.sql` handles it. Alerts route through the standard on-call channel. For direct inspection of the reservations database, use the connection string below.

primary connection of yagep-kahip = redis://giliel_svc:zYiKsLL2PLpfPL@db-348f.xolmarsys.corp:5432/fenwyn

Changed defaults in Splitfork, our assignment service. Bucketing now uses sticky hashing per account instead of per session, and the holdout slice grew from 2% to 5%. Callers relying on session-level reassignment must opt in explicitly. Review the diff against the new baseline; the updated default configuration is listed below.

config for tagep-kajof:
[casir]
port = 6379
region = south-1
host = casir.paliqdyn.example
team = tamax
timeout_ms = 250
retries = 2

Ticket PART-214 for the weekly sync: the Cobblewick migration job that repartitions the events table by month failed its signature check on Tuesday. The partition DDL bundle was signed before last week's rotation, so the scheduler rejected it. Fix is to re-sign and resubmit. The current signing key for the bundle follows.

rollout seal: bky9_PeXH1fTLY